    U.S. Senators Angus King (I-ME) and Cindy Hyde-Smith (R-MS) and Representatives Madeleine Dean (D-PA-04) and Mariannette Miller-Meeks (R-IA-01) introduced bipartisan legislation on May 5, 2025, making it a federal crime to assault a hospital staff member on the job.

    The Save Healthcare Workers Act would help deter and prevent violence against healthcare workers by making it easier to prosecute individuals who commit violence against hospital employees.

    Betty Long, MHA, RN Founder & CEO of Guardian Nurses

    Betty Long began her career in 1986 as a critical care nurse. Over the next 20 years, she gained experience in clinical, management and consulting roles. Long is a nurse always and an entrepreneur since 2003 when she used her knowledge of how the healthcare system works to found a company that makes the system work better for patients and their families. Through her leadership, Guardian Nurses Healthcare Advocates has grown to more than 58 employees and serves business, health and welfare funds, and private clients throughout the United States.

    A nurse-owned, nurse-run company, Guardian Nurses deploys RNs to provide patient advocacy and high-touch care management services. With the caring concern that is typical of nurses and the clinical knowledge that comes from 20+ years of experience, Long’s nurse advocates drive timely, top-quality care that results in better outcomes for patients. Although Guardian Nurses serves individuals and families, its clients are primarily unions, health & welfare funds, and corporations that self-insure for employee healthcare.

    Long has won many awards in her career, but the most satisfying was seeing her one-of-a-kind Mobile Care Coordinator program recognized by the prestigious American Academy of Nursing as a 2023 Edge Runner. In 2024, Long received the Mary Ann Garrigan award which is presented annually by the Howard Gotlieb Archival Research Center Nursing Archives Associates in Boston, MA.

    Long has become a nationally recognized expert and speaker on patient advocacy and care coordination, with special expertise in critical care, long-term care and geriatric care management. She is a member of the Mid-Atlantic Chapter of the Case Management Society of America, the Pennsylvania Organization of Nursing Leadership, as well as the Forum of Executive Women in Philadelphia. Currently, she serves as President of the Board of Trustees for The Nightingale Awards of Pennsylvania.
